Small Faucet for Bar Sink
Small bar sinks can provide a convenient and practical solution for additional food preparation or cleanup needs in kitchens, wet bars, or home bars. To complement these compact fixtures, selecting a small faucet that fits the bar sink's scale and functionality is crucial.
Size Considerations:
When choosing a small faucet for a bar sink, it's important to consider the sink's dimensions and available space. Measuring the hole spacing, which is the distance between the two holes where the faucet is mounted, and the overall height and reach of the faucet is essential to ensure a proper fit.
Mounting Options:
Small faucets for bar sinks typically come with two common mounting options: deck-mounted and wall-mounted. Deck-mounted faucets are installed directly on the sink, offering a more traditional setup. Wall-mounted faucets are mounted on the wall behind the sink, requiring no holes in the sink itself. This option provides a more streamlined and contemporary look.
Handle Types:
Faucets for bar sinks come with various handle types to suit different preferences. Single-handle faucets feature one lever that controls both water flow and temperature, offering convenience and ease of use. Dual-handle faucets have separate handles for hot and cold water, allowing for more precise temperature adjustments.
Materials:
The material of the faucet can impact its durability and aesthetics. Common materials used in small faucets for bar sinks include brass, stainless steel, and plastic. Brass faucets offer durability and a traditional look, while stainless steel faucets are known for their resistance to corrosion and a modern appearance. Plastic faucets are an economical option, but they may not be as durable as metal faucets.
Features:
Consider additional features that can enhance the functionality of the faucet. Some faucets offer pull-out or pull-down sprayers, providing extended reach and flexibility for cleaning or rinsing. Aerators can reduce water flow and create a softer stream, saving water and minimizing splashing. Temperature limiters can prevent scalding by setting a maximum temperature for the water.
Style and Finish:
The style and finish of the faucet should complement the overall design of the bar sink and surrounding décor. Modern faucets often feature clean lines and geometric shapes, while traditional faucets have more ornate and detailed designs. The finish, such as chrome, brushed nickel, or matte black, can match the existing fixtures or create a contrasting accent.
By considering these factors, you can choose a small faucet that not only fits the size and functionality of your bar sink but also complements the style and décor of your space.
